Programming Resources
21.8K subscribers
1.78K photos
6 videos
4 files
108 links
Here I share my programming related resources during working or at my free times ☺️

Talk to me if you have any query: @Mojtabaeuler
Download Telegram
Discover the neighborhoods you’ll love with Hoodmaps! This innovative platform allows users to explore cities through the lens of community-generated data, highlighting the best spots for living, working, and playing based on personal preferences.
آیا به دنبال محله‌هایی هستید که از آن‌ها خوشتان بیاید؟ هوودمپ یک پلتفرم نوآورانه است که به کاربران این امکان را می‌دهد تا شهرها را از دید داده‌های تولیدشده توسط جامعه کاوش کنند و بهترین مکان‌ها برای زندگی، کار و تفریح را بر اساس سلیقه شخصی خود پیدا کنند.

#Fun #Neighborhoods #CityExploration #Community #UrbanLiving
@pythony

https://hoodmaps.com
3Blue1Brown offers in-depth explanations of complex mathematical concepts through stunning visualizations and animations. The content ranges from calculus and linear algebra to neural networks, making advanced math more accessible and engaging.
این سایت مفاهیم پیچیده ریاضی را با استفاده از انیمیشن‌های جذاب توضیح میده.

#Math #Visualization #Education #3Blue1Brown
@pythony

https://www.3blue1brown.com
A Tool to help you explore FFmpeg filters. To use it, simply add filters from the list on the left and click on the filters in the node editor to modify options. This makes it easy to experiment with different configurations and understand how each filter affects your media.
این سایت ابزاری برای کمک به شما در کاوش فیلترهای FFmpeg است. برای استفاده: فیلترها را از لیست سمت چپ اضافه کنید و روی فیلترها در ویرایشگر نود کلیک کنید تا گزینه‌ها را تغییر دهید.

#Video #Multimedia #FFmpeg #Filters #Multimedia #VideoEditing
@pythony

https://ffmpeg.lav.io
A comprehensive guide to understanding the inner workings of web browsers. This site delves into how browsers parse HTML, CSS, and JavaScript, rendering the web pages we interact with daily. It’s perfect for developers wanting to grasp the architecture of modern browsers and optimize their web applications.
این سایت راهنمایی جامع برای درک نحوه کارکرد داخلی مرورگرهاست. به بررسی نحوه پردازش HTML، CSS و JavaScript توسط مرورگرها می‌پردازه و برای توسعه‌دهندگانی که می‌خواهند معماری مرورگرهای مدرن را بهتر بشناسند، بسیار مناسبه.

#WebDevelopment #Browser #Coding #Programming #HTML #JavaScript
@pythony

https://browser.engineering
A comprehensive guide comparing LocalStorage, IndexedDB, cookies, OPFS, SQLite, and WASM for storing data in web applications. This article explores the strengths and weaknesses of each option, helping developers choose the right storage solution for their needs. Perfect for understanding the trade-offs between browser-native and more modern methods like WASM-backed databases.
این مقاله به بررسی و مقایسه LocalStorage، IndexedDB، کوکی‌ها، OPFS، SQLite و WASM برای ذخیره‌سازی داده‌ها در برنامه‌های وب می‌پردازد. نقاط قوت و ضعف هر روش را بیان کرده و به توسعه‌دهندگان کمک می‌کند تا راهکار مناسب را انتخاب کنند.

#WebStorage #IndexedDB #SQLite #WASM #WebDevelopment
@pythony

https://rxdb.info/articles/localstorage-indexeddb-cookies-opfs-sqlite-wasm.html
Supabase provides an open-source Firebase alternative with all the backend services you need to build your applications. You can create databases, authentication systems, APIs, and more—quickly and easily. The platform is scalable, reliable, and fully customizable, which makes it a solid choice for modern developers.
این سایت یک جایگزین متن‌باز برای Firebase فراهم می‌کند که شامل تمام خدمات backend مورد نیاز برای ساخت برنامه‌های شما است. می‌توانید پایگاه‌داده‌ها، سیستم‌های احراز هویت، APIها و موارد دیگر را به‌سرعت ایجاد کنید. این پلتفرم مقیاس‌پذیر، قابل‌اعتماد و کاملاً قابل تنظیم است و انتخاب خوبی برای توسعه‌دهندگان مدرن محسوب می‌شود.

#Programming #Backend #Supabase #OpenSource #Firebase
@pythony

https://supabase.com
Credly is a platform that allows you to showcase your achievements with digital credentials. Whether it's professional certifications, skills recognition, or course completions, Credly makes it easy to share and verify your expertise across the web.
پلتفرم Credly به شما امکان می‌دهد که دستاوردهای خود را با مدارک دیجیتال به اشتراک بگذارید. چه گواهینامه‌های حرفه‌ای، چه شناسایی مهارت‌ها و چه تکمیل دوره‌ها، Credly به راحتی به شما کمک می‌کند که تخصص خود را به صورت آنلاین تأیید و به اشتراک بگذارید.

#DigitalCredentials #ProfessionalGrowth #SkillsVerification
@pythony

https://www.credly.com/
Supabase provides a powerful, scalable backend as a service that integrates seamlessly with your apps. Offering an open-source alternative to Firebase, it includes a SQL database, authentication, and real-time subscriptions.
اینن دو تا سایت در کنار هم میتونن یک سرویس back-end قدرتمند و مقیاس‌پذیر ارائه بدن. supabase یه جورایی سرویس دیتابیس Postgres در بستر REST عه یا چیزی شبیه به postgREST و buildship هم یه ابزار low-code برای کارهای مختلف backend به حساب میاد.

#Database #Supabase #SQL #Realtime #Backend
@pythony

https://supabase.com
https://buildship.com
Discover trending charts for your favorite TV shows. Track popularity over time, compare shows, and stay updated with real-time data. With intuitive visuals and insightful analytics, tvcharts.co is your go-to for exploring what's hot on TV.
تو این سایت نمودارهای محبوبیت برنامه‌های تلویزیونی رو میتونید به صورت قسمت به قسمت ببینید.داده‌ها رو از imdb میگیره و بصورت یه جا میتونید ببینید.

#Fun #TV #Analytics #Charts #Trending #Entertainment
@pythony

https://tvcharts.co
LLM Agents Learning Platform provides a comprehensive guide to understanding and implementing AI agents based on large language models. Whether you're an AI enthusiast or a developer, this site offers valuable resources and tutorials to deepen your knowledge and build powerful AI-driven solutions.
این سایت پلتفرم یادگیری جامع برای درک و پیاده‌سازی عوامل هوش مصنوعی مبتنی بر مدل‌های زبانی بزرگ است. چه علاقه‌مند به هوش مصنوعی باشید یا توسعه‌دهنده، این سایت منابع و آموزش‌های ارزشمندی برای ارتقای دانش و ساخت راه‌حل‌های قدرتمند ارائه می‌دهد.

#AI #LanguageModels #MachineLearning #AIagents #LLM
@pythony

https://llmagents-learning.org/f24
OpenAI Swarm is a platform for developing and deploying distributed AI models that work together in an efficient and scalable way. It allows you to create, test, and manage swarms of AI agents, each performing tasks in a collaborative network, making it ideal for large-scale AI research and applications.
شرکت OpenAI محصول جدید آزمایشی مبتنی بر multi-Agent ارائه داده به نام swarm که باهاش میتونین چند تا Agent اجرا کنید و به هرکدوم کارهای مختلف بدین. نیاز به API key داره برای chatgpt 4 و هنوز بصورت خیلی رسمی منتشر نشده و آزمایشگاهیه هنوز.

#AI #Swarm #DistributedComputing #Collaboration #ArtificialIntelligence
@pythony

https://github.com/openai/swarm
Explore an exceptional collection of resources for mastering low-level software design. This repository offers valuable insights into system architecture, algorithms, and design patterns that every backend engineer should know. Perfect for building solid, scalable software solutions from the ground up.
این سایت مجموعه‌ای بی‌نظیر از منابع برای تسلط بر طراحی نرم‌افزار سطح پایین ارائه می‌دهد. شامل معماری سیستم، الگوریتم‌ها و الگوهای طراحی برای ساخت نرم‌افزارهای مقیاس‌پذیر.

#SoftwareDesign #LowLevelDesign #Architecture
@pythony

https://github.com/ashishps1/awesome-low-level-design
Beeceptor lets you mock a REST API without coding. Create a mock API endpoint in seconds to inspect and log incoming HTTP requests, making it easy to test and debug your applications.
این سایت به شما اجازه می‌دهد بدون نیاز به کدنویسی یک API ساختگی ایجاد کنید و درخواست‌های HTTP را به راحتی بررسی کنید.

#API #Testing #Beeceptor #WebDev #MockAPI #Mock
@pythony

https://beeceptor.com/
Obsidian is a powerful knowledge management and note-taking app that organizes your thoughts like a second brain. With its graph view, backlinks, and community plugins.

یکی از اپ‌هایی که یه رقیب برای notion و نرم‌افزارهای نت‌برداری مشابه محسوب میشه با این تفاوت که یه دید گراف‌طور به کل نوشته‌هاتون میده و حس خیلی بهتری از اونها پیدا میکند. مخصوصا اگه تعداد نوشته‌ها خیلی زیاد بشه و سرچ کردن توش دردسر داشته باشه.

#Productivity #NoteTaking #KnowledgeManagement #Obsidian
@pythony

https://obsidian.md
Generate UI with simple text prompts. Copy, paste, ship.
کارهای UI ای و مخصوصا برای Frontend رو میتونید علاوه بر claude و chatgpt و بقیه رفقا به این ابزار بدین که مخصوص فرانت‌اند درست شده

#DevTools #Coding #Productivity
@pythony

https://v0.dev
Replit is an online platform that allows you to code collaboratively from anywhere, directly in your browser. Whether you're working on a solo project or with a team, Replit provides a seamless coding environment with live collaboration, debugging, and deployment options, making programming accessible for everyone with AI assistant.
این سایت یه AI assistant داره که علاوه برکمک تو کد زدن میتونه کدتون رو روی cloud بیاره بالا بدون خرید هیچ سروری فقط با یک کلیک. البته که اصلی‌ترین فیچرهاش از یه جا بعد پولی میشه ولی خیلی ایده جالبیه که کل مسیر از اول تا اخر توی browser انجام میشه.

#Programming #Coding #Collaboration #Development
@pythony

https://replit.com
Localhost.run provides a secure and easy way to share your local server with the world. With a simple command, you can create a temporary public URL for your localhost, making it a great alternative to ngrok for sharing projects or testing webhooks without complex setups.
این سایت به شما امکان میده سرور محلی خود را به روشی امن و ساده با دیگران به اشتراک بگذارید. با یک فرمان ساده، میتونید یک آدرس عمومی موقت برای localhost خود ایجاد کنید و به عنوان جایگزینی برای ngrok استفاده کنید،

#Networking #Development #Localhost #Tunneling
@pythony

https://localhost.run
Your Weekly Python Digest - The Friday Loop! Get the latest Python tips, tutorials, and insights delivered every Friday. The Friday Loop is your go-to resource for Python development, whether you're a beginner or an advanced coder. Stay in the loop with fresh Python content every week!
جدیدترین محتواهای پایتونی هر جمعه، با نکات، آموزش‌ها، و مطالب جدید در زمینه پایتون همراه باشید.

#Python #Programming #WeeklyDigest #CodeWithPython
@pythony

https://thefridayloop.com
WireMock is a flexible tool for mocking APIs, enabling you to simulate HTTP-based services. Whether you’re testing REST, SOAP, or other HTTP protocols, WireMock helps create a controlled environment for testing without relying on external APIs. Perfect for speeding up development and ensuring consistent test results.

ابزاری انعطاف‌پذیر برای شبیه‌سازی API که به شما اجازه می‌دهد خدمات HTTP را به راحتی شبیه‌سازی کنید. ایده‌آل برای تست REST، SOAP و سایر پروتکل‌های HTTP، بدون نیاز به اتصال به APIهای خارجی.

#Testing #APIs #Mocking #Development #WireMock
@pythony

https://wiremock.org/
Easily format dates and times in Python with these tools!
Whether you need codes, examples, or syntax help, these sites have you covered.
این ۳ تا سایت بصورت تقلب‌طور نکات کلی در مورد format string توی پایتون رو خلاصه کردن و با مثال توضیح دادن

#Python #DateTime #CodingTools
@pythony

https://strftime.org/
https://pyformat.info/
https://www.strfti.me/